Sec. 254.044. REPORTING OF POLITICAL CONTRIBUTIONS AND EXPENDITURES MADE USING CREDIT CARD. (a) A candidate or officeholder who accepts a political contribution made using a credit card shall:
(1) for a political contribution for which a processing fee is deducted by the credit card issuer from the political contribution amount:
(A) report as a political contribution the full amount, including the deducted amount; and
(B) report as a political expenditure the deducted amount; and
(2) for a political contribution for which a processing fee is paid by the person making the political contribution in excess of the political contribution amount, report only as a political contribution the full amount the candidate or officeholder accepts, not including the amount paid in excess of the political contribution amount.
(b) A candidate or officeholder who accepts a political contribution described by Subsection (a)(2) is not required to report the excess amount paid as a processing fee by the person making the political contribution.
